Any accident foreseen here?
A battery in a dozer shovel (otherwise called a traxcavator) has run down. The operator tries to charge it by connecting it with that of a nearby hydraulic excavator with an electric cable. Another worker standing on the dozer shovel proceeds to starting the engine.
Now what accident do you anticipate from this picture?

This is the accident resulted!
The shift lever of the dozer shovel was in the REAR position. And what is worse, the parking brake had not been applied. Thus when the worker switched on the ignition key, the machine jerked backward. The operator was sandwiched between the two machines and killed.

Tips for forestalling similar accidents
1. An operator of dozer shovels will surely take all precautions for preventing the machines from runaway such as applying the parking brake, when he/she leaves the operator's seat.
2. Check if the machine will not start all of sudden before switching on the engine.
3. Do not allow anybody an access to a construction vehicle in operation and the neighborhood, if and when there is the danger that he/she may be hurt through coming into contact with it.
4. Should a battery of construction vehicle run down while in use under the normal conditions, it should be replaced with new one.
